Before You Rent – Security in Self Storage

When choosing a self storage unit, it is more than just looking at size and price but making sure what you are storing will be safe. Whether you’re storing family heirlooms, business stock or just clearing space at home, security should be the top of any checklist.

Start with buildings that have strong physical security. Perimeter fencing, secure gates and well-lit premises – these are all things intruders don’t want to see. Ask about access controls - Do sites have keypads, individual entry codes or even biometric systems? The more personalised the access, the better! CCTV coverage is another must-have. Make sure that cameras are installed in all critical parts of the facility, such as entrances and exits, corridors etc. The cameras should record around-the-clock and personnel should monitor the footage, ideally. Secure on-site manpower or regular verification of security patrols will definitely provide an extra layer of protection and peace as well.

In the unit check for secure, lockable doors. You may have a padlock like most places who use high-security locks and some allow personal padlocks too. Ensure that the unit is cleaned, dried properly and well kept as this also helps in preventing any damage or loss.

Do not be afraid to ask. Ask what would happen if someone breaks in, how incidents are to be logged and does the storage room come with insurance or is it an add-on?

When you give security top billing in selecting a self storage site, your peace of mind takes over and allows time to focus on what is far more important.

What to Consider When Refurbishing Your Kitchen

Refurbishing a kitchen is a major project that involves a lot of planning and budgeting. A well-planned kitchen refurb can improve how you cook and spend time in your kitchen. Here we share our guide about what you need to consider before embarking on a kitchen refurb project.

Space and Layout

Start by thinking about how you use your kitchen. The layout should make it easy to move between cooking, washing and storage areas. The “work triangle” – the space between the sink, stove and fridge – should be convenient. Make sure there’s enough counter space for preparing food and that your storage areas are easy to reach.

Personal Style and Taste

Your kitchen should reflect your home’s personality. Some people prefer a modern look, while others like a more traditional design. Material and Finish Choices

Kitchens are high-use areas, so durable materials are important. Cabinets, worktops and flooring should be able to withstand heat, steam, moisture and regular cleaning. Laminate, quartz and solid wood are all popular choices. For finishes, consider how the different textures – from matte to glossy – will look under your kitchen lighting.

Colour Scheme

The colour scheme you choose will set the mood for the space. Light colours can make smaller kitchens feel bigger and more open, while darker tones can add warmth. Neutrals are always timeless, but adding a bold colour can make the room more distinctive and memorable.

Lifestyle Choices

Think about how your kitchen supports your daily routine. Families might prioritise easy-to-clean surfaces and extra seating, while keen cooks may want more worktop space and professional gadgets and appliances. Storage solutions like pull-out drawers or hidden bins can make the space more organised and easier to work in. Matching your design to your lifestyle makes sure that your kitchen doesn’t just look good but also works well.

House Repairs That Cannot Wait

Do you often postpone domestic fixes, until next week? Others demand immediate attention. Failure to address an issue from the get-go could result in further damage, unsafe conditions and costlier bills. Here are some repairs you should never delay:

Water Leaks

But even little leaks result in big problems. Water damage can quickly spread, growing mould and causing structural decay. Leaks from pipes, dripping taps or those brown seepage stains on a ceiling should alert you to promptly check and seal.

Electrical Issues

Other warning signs include flickering lights, burning smells and sparking outlets. Electrical problems and fire safety issues should be immediately taken care of by a licensed expert. Never ignore electrical problems.

Blocked Drains

When a drain slows down or stops, there are likely some blockages developing that will only get worse. If not treated they can lead to leaks, pipe corrosion and bad smells. Fix drainage problems before they become worse.

Roof Damage

Gas Leaks

Call emergency services and leave as soon as possible when you smell the gas. Gas leaks can prove fatal and must be addressed by an emergency technician. Always remember that DIY gas systems repairs are nothing but a NO.

Structural Cracks

Cracks in walls and foundations that are significant or spreading can be a sign of major structural problems. Have them checked as soon as possible so that nothing gets worse.
